    Finally got to try dine-in and confirmed, I had to roll myself home lol. Should've read my previous…read morereview to warn myself. Luckily, I was smart enough to wear stretchy pants. We went for a weekday lunch and they have beef ribs on special every Wednesday. I originally ordered a 6-rib dinner but our server advised that because beef ribs are a lot larger than pork, that a half rack of beef ribs is actually a 3-4 ribs, so I took his advice and got that. Glad I did! They were definitely huge. I asked for no beans, but got the coleslaw, cornbread, and fries, that came with it. While the sides were good, I focused on eating the ribs in-house because they were piping hot and the fries and cornbread could be easily heated later, if needed, without overcooking. The beef ribs take a bit longer, so keep it in mind if you're in a rush. The barbecue sauce had a nice kick to it, not necessarily spicy, but a kick, and also sweet and a bit tangy. The meat wasn't fall-off-the-bone and had some chew, which I didn't mind. Huge portion for sure! There was also a generous portion of fries. I call them Costco fries because most people understand what I'm talking about when I say that's the kind of breading/fry. I loved that cornbread came with the meal and wasn't an additional cost. I just wish it came with a pat of butter or something. If you're looking for a toddler-friendly meal, you can get the Buffalo fingers starter just plain, without it tossed in sauce. There are a ton of different awards, articles, posters, and signs that line the walls, including one that says they're now pouring Broadhead Amber Ale. Service was great, very attentive, fast, and friendly. We came just before the lunch rush, around 11:30-11:45am and there were plenty of tables and it was easy to order and receive our meals in a timely fashion. Family-friendly place as well, though I think they only have a couple of high chairs. Loved that it was laid back and they didn't mind our excitable little dude.
